Winning is always nice, but doing so behind a season-high score is even better (just ask Santa Fe Trail). They enjoyed a cozy 76-58 win over the Royal Valley Panthers on Friday. Given the Chargers' advantage in MaxPreps' Kansas basketball rankings (they are ranked 25th, while the Panthers are ranked 178th), the result wasn't entirely unexpected.
The victory was the fourth in a row for Santa Fe Trail, bringing their record for this year to 9-1. Those victories came thanks to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 61.3 points per game. As for Royal Valley, they have been struggling recently as they've lost four of their last five games, which put a noticeable dent in their 3-5-2 record this season.
Santa Fe Trail has already played their next match (against Chapman), but no score has been uploaded at the time of writing. Royal Valley did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next contest, a 0-0 tie against Rock Creek on the 25th.
